I look at this draw heavy flop, my weak made hand, the small pot, the largish stack I have, my reverse implied odds, the implied odds I'm giving everyone else, and the very low odds that I'll be able to pick up enough chips to justify all that risk and decide that I'll find better situations later and just check fold the flop.
